Jordan is 8 months old today. I can't believe how big/old he's getting. The past couple months have gone by so fast. He's such a happy baby these days. He just loves scooting around and playing with anything he can find. He seems like he's going to get into things a ton more than Jack ever did. I don't remember Jackson ever getting into things, especially if I didn't want him to get into it. But Jordan loves to try to open all the cupboards especially the one with garbage in it. And he also loves to try to play with outlets which is also a dangerous activity. He has been showing a lot of interest in going downstairs but can't do it. He just scoots toward the stairs so happily and when I say Jordan he looks at me with a huge smile than continues toward them. I need to teach him how to go down them backwards. He's started to pull himself to stand a little. He only does it on lower things like the bathtub and the boat at the mall. But he doesn't really try on the couch, even when I try really hard to tempt him to stand up by putting the things he likes to play with up there. Today to celebrate his birthday I let him try to eat some chewing foods. He had puffs baby snacks and cheerios. He seems to like the cheerios better. He makes a funny face when he gets one in his mouth. He loves when people pay attention to him. It makes him so happy. But he is generally pretty happy unless he's tired or hungry or both.
